The South Carolina State Library is a government administration organization based in Columbia, South Carolina. It supports and inspires a statewide community of learners, providing services that aim to enhance access to information and educational opportunities across the state. Serving public users and libraries through its statewide mission, the library operates from office hours on weekdays and maintains a mailing and contact presence for inquiries and support. The institution is located at 1500 Senate Street, at the corner of Senate and Bull Streets, and its activities align with broader public sector goals of education, literacy, and community development.
